92python Posted April 1, 2011 Share Posted April 1, 2011 I got a string / cable from Top Pin archery and after 150 or so shots I like it. Had it made out of the Astro Flight and that seems to be the ticket. Word on that material says it is very strong, not bad on stretch, and not too fuzzy. After some time shooting the string in and getting ATA right I have had no peep rotation. I have shot Winners Choice and Vaportrail before this and while it is still early I am liking this new string. Seems well made and the shop liked it too.
